What are some common challenges faced by philosophy professors when engaging students in critical thinking?

Philosophy professors often encounter the challenge of sparking genuine interest and critical engagement among students, especially those new to abstract reasoning or diverse philosophical perspectives. Creating an inclusive classroom where students feel comfortable expressing and debating ideas requires careful facilitation and sensitivity to diverse viewpoints. Professors must also balance covering complex material with fostering open discussion, all while helping students develop strong argumentative and analytical skills essential for success in philosophy and beyond.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a philanthropy man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Philanthropy Manager, you need strong fundraising expertise, relationship-building skills, and a background in nonprofit management or a related field, often supported by a bachelor's degree. Familiarity with donor management systems (such as Salesforce or Raiser’s Edge) and certifications like Certified Fund Raising Executive (CFRE) are valuable. Outstanding communication, strategic thinking, and leadership abilities set top performers apart in this position. These skills ensure effective donor engagement, successful campaign execution, and the advancement of the organization’s mission.
